Job Description
As Head of Engineering, you will own the technical architecture and delivery for a platform managing cross-border mobile subscriptions. Leading a team of seven engineers, you will transform startup chaos into predictable, scalable systems. This is a high-authority role focused on reliability, performance, and shipping features that serve customers in eight countries.

Why this role is remarkable
- Take full ownership of the technical backbone for the world's first unified global mobile subscription platform.
- Join a live, revenue-generating product already operating in eight countries with a goal to lead the market by 2026.
- Exercise real authority over engineering standards, hiring, and architecture without the red tape of large enterprises.
What you will do
- Lead technical architecture, infrastructure, and system scalability to support rapid international expansion.
- Establish rigorous release planning and delivery processes to ensure monthly feature commitments are consistently met.
- Scale the engineering team from seven members while maintaining high performance, code quality, and operational reliability.
The ideal candidate
- Proven experience as a senior engineering leader who has successfully scaled teams and products in a high-growth environment.
- Deep technical background in backend systems, with the ability to lead by example and dive into code when necessary.
- Strong history of accountability, capable of managing the 'messy middle' between early-stage startup and established company processes.
